    No. The entire offroad community as a whole is already set on the CB standard and no handheld tranceiver you can buy without needing a FCC license will beat a CB.

    Just buy a CB and jump onboard with the probably hundreds of thousands of off-roader in the country. They are cheap, work well if configured and tuned properly, and everyone already has one.
